[Bug 917810] New: frequent crashes of autofs on Factory
http://bugzilla.suse.com/show_bug.cgi?id=917810 Bug ID: 917810 Summary: frequent crashes of autofs on Factory Classification: openSUSE Product: openSUSE Factory Version: 201502* Hardware: Other OS: Other Status: NEW Severity: Normal Priority: P5 - None Component: Basesystem Assignee: bnc-team-screening@forge.provo.novell.com Reporter: dmueller@suse.com QA Contact: qa-bugs@suse.de Found By: --- Blocker: --- autofs with NIS integration enabled seems to crash frequently on Factory. Current trace is: (gdb) bt #0 0x00007f18ef4681b8 in __lll_unlock_elision () from /lib64/libpthread.so.0 #1 0x00007f18ef8befdd in master_mutex_unlock () at master.c:57 #2 0x00007f18ef8a5b7c in handle_mounts_cleanup (arg=0x7f18eff4f620) at automount.c:1606 #3 0x00007f18ef8a6505 in handle_mounts (arg=0x7fffa9930a00) at automount.c:1792 #4 0x00007f18ef45f0a4 in start_thread () from /lib64/libpthread.so.0 #5 0x00007f18ee2cb7fd in clone () from /lib64/libc.so.6 -- You are receiving this mail because: You are on the CC list for the bug.
